I have a company logo that is a jpeg that I’m trying to use as signage. I created anew decal and placed it on the structure. The issue is that the jpeg has a white background; I just want red letters. I brought the jpeg into Photoshop made the background black and the text white to use as a cut-out; with minimum success. It appears that the size of the cut-out is incorrect; I have tried for hours playing with the size of the cut-out. Is there a way to use a decal with no background?

Use a PNG file.... it create an Alpha channel and the background it's transparent...
